Description

A kind of dip dyeing apparatus for textile cloth
Technical field
The present invention relates to textile technology field, specially a kind of dip dyeing apparatus for textile cloth.
Background technology
Weaving original meaning is taken from spinning and the general name weaved cotton cloth, but with the continuous hair of weaving knowledge hierarchy and scientific system Exhibition and perfect, after the technology such as particularly non-woven textile material and three-dimensional be composite braided is produced, weaving is not only traditional spinning With weave cotton cloth, also including nonwoven fabric technology, three dimensional weaving technique, electrostatic nanometer net-forming technology etc., weaving is roughly divided into spinning with compiling Two procedures are knitted, Chinese foremost textile is no more than silk, and the transaction of silk has driven the exchange and friendship of oriental and occidental cultures Logical development, also have impact on business and the military affairs in west indirectly.
Current textile cloth is, it is necessary to which some clothes are dyed when processing, and existing cloth is logical in dyeing Often all it is that cloth is put into color pond to be dyed, cloth ensure that cloth contaminates with the time that the pigment in color pond is contacted The effect of color, existing cloth can not control the time that cloth is dyed in dyeing, making it difficult to ensure the Color of cloth, And cloth, in dyeing, cloth can be dried, the dyestuff on cloth is dried, while dyestuff unnecessary on cloth can exist Dropped during drying, the drying degree that drying is inconvenient to adjust cloth is carried out after existing cloth dyeing, so as to be difficult to ensure that cloth Color.
The content of the invention
It is an object of the invention to provide a kind of dip dyeing apparatus for textile cloth, possess when can control the cloth to dye Between and cloth can be controlled to dry the advantage of degree after dyeing, solve and be difficult to control to the dyeing time of cloth and be inconvenient to control The problem of cloth drying degree processed can reduce cloth Color.

Compared with prior art, beneficial effects of the present invention are as follows:
1st, using cooperatively by installing pipe, movable sleeve, compression spring, kelly, fixture block, mounting groove and neck of the invention, So that cloth is imported into when being dyed in paint can by the second fabric guide roll, movable sleeve can be allowed by the compression of compression spring After fixture block on kelly can be released out of mounting groove neck, it can stick into the neck of different height, so as to pass through difference The neck of height controls height of second fabric guide roll in paint can, so that time when controlling the cloth to dye, so as to allow cloth Material is sufficiently dyed in paint can, so as to ensure that the Color of cloth.
2nd, using cooperatively by movable sleeve, compression spring and motion bar of the invention so that after pressing motion bar, movable sleeve At any time compression spring can be driven to be compressed, so as to become more to facilitate when allowing fixture block to stick into different necks.
3rd, using cooperatively by portable plate, clamp, nut and threaded rod of the invention so that the electrothermal tube to drying cloth It can be arranged on when mounted between portable plate and the deep-slotted chip breaker of clamp, threaded rod be rotated, after threaded rod is connected with nut, to electricity Heat pipe is fixed, so that convenient dismantle to electrothermal tube.
4th, using cooperatively by adjustable plate, rack rails and travelling gear of the invention so that travelling gear is when rotating, transmission Gear can allow adjustable plate to drive mounted electrothermal tube to be lifted by rack rails, thus control electrothermal tube and dyed cloth it Between distance, so as to control electrothermal tube to the drying degree of cloth, it is ensured that the Color of cloth.
5th, using cooperatively by collecting hood, conduit and collecting box of the invention so that the painting dropped during drying dyed cloth Material can be flowed in collecting hood, and the coating in collecting hood is flowed in collecting box by conduit, so that when conveniently being dried to cloth Coating is collected.

In use, textile cloth is passed into the second fabric guide roll 5 by the first fabric guide roll 3, passed by the 3rd fabric guide roll 18 To the 4th fabric guide roll 26, motion bar 13 is pressed, the fixture block 15 allowed on kelly 14 is released out of neck 22, allow fixture block 15 to moving down It is dynamic, it is stuck in the neck 22 of different height, fixture block 15 moves down the second fabric guide roll 5 of drive and moved down in coating case 1, and cloth exists The time of transmission in coating case 1 is lengthened, and cloth is delivered in casing 19 after contaminating, and starts electro-motor 32, travelling gear 30 By rack rails 29 drive adjustable plate 28 move down, allow installation electrothermal tube 38 close to transmission cloth, so as to control electrothermal tube The drying degree of 38 pairs of clothes, the coating dropped during drying is collected into collecting box 41 by collecting hood 39.
In summary, this is used for the dip dyeing apparatus of textile cloth, passes through kelly 14, fixture block 15, mounting seat 20, travelling gear 30th, the use of rack rails 29 and adjustable plate 28, solves and is difficult to control to the dyeing time of cloth and is inconvenient to control cloth to dry journey The problem of degree can reduce cloth Color.
